Understanding Brush Bristle Material and Its Impact on Artwork

The type of bristle material used in stiff synthetic angle brushes plays a crucial role in determining the overall quality and performance of the brush. Synthetic bristles are made from nylon or polyester and are known for their durability and resistance to wear and tear. They are also less prone to shedding and can withstand heavy use, making them an ideal choice for artists who work with thick paints or heavy textures. In contrast, natural bristles are made from animal hair and are known for their softness and flexibility. However, they can be more prone to shedding and may not be as durable as synthetic bristles. Understanding the differences between synthetic and natural bristles can help artists choose the right brush for their specific needs and techniques.
When it comes to stiff synthetic angle brushes, the bristle material is particularly important because it affects the brush’s ability to hold its shape and maintain its stiffness. Synthetic bristles are generally stiffer than natural bristles, which makes them well-suited for creating sharp lines and defined edges. However, they can also be more prone to scratching or dragging across the canvas, which can be a problem for artists who are looking for a smooth, even finish. To mitigate this issue, some manufacturers use a blend of synthetic and natural bristles, which can provide a balance between stiffness and flexibility.
In addition to the type of bristle material, the length and thickness of the bristles can also impact the performance of the brush. Longer bristles can provide more flexibility and movement, while shorter bristles can offer more control and precision. Thicker bristles can also hold more paint and create thicker textures, while thinner bristles can produce finer lines and details. By understanding the relationship between bristle length, thickness, and material, artists can choose the right brush for their specific needs and techniques.

Techniques for Using Stiff Synthetic Angle Brushes in Art

Stiff synthetic angle brushes are versatile tools that can be used in a variety of artistic techniques and applications. One of the most common uses for these brushes is in creating sharp lines and defined edges. By holding the brush at a 45-degree angle and using the tip to create fine lines and details, artists can add texture and depth to their artwork. The stiff synthetic bristles can also be used to create thick, impasto textures by dragging the brush across the canvas in a smooth, even motion.
Another technique for using stiff synthetic angle brushes is in creating bold, expressive strokes. By holding the brush at a more vertical angle and using the full length of the bristles, artists can create sweeping strokes and gestures that add energy and movement to their artwork. The synthetic bristles can also be used to create subtle, nuanced transitions between colors by blending and merging different hues and shades.
In addition to these techniques, stiff synthetic angle brushes can also be used in a variety of other applications, such as creating fine details and textures in miniature paintings, or adding subtle shading and depth to larger-scale works. Maintenance and Care of Stiff Synthetic Angle Brushes

To get the most out of stiff synthetic angle brushes, it is essential to properly maintain and care for them. One of the most important things to do is to clean the brushes regularly. Synthetic bristles can be prone to shedding and becoming misshapen if they are not cleaned properly, which can affect the performance and precision of the brush. Artists should use mild soap and warm water to clean their brushes, and av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that can damage the bristles.
Another important thing to do is to shape and condition the brushes regularly. Synthetic bristles can become stiff and brittle if they are not properly conditioned, which can make them prone to breaking or shedding. Artists can use a brush conditioner or a small amount of oil to keep the bristles flexible and supple. They should also shape the brushes regularly to maintain their shape and prevent them from becoming misshapen.
In addition to cleaning and conditioning, artists should also store their stiff synthetic angle brushes properly. The brushes should be kept in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ture. They should also be stored in a protective case or container to prevent them from becoming damaged or bent. By properly storing and maintaining their brushes, artists can help to extend their lifespan and keep them in good working condition.

Brush Size and Shape

The size and shape of the brush are critical factors to consider when buying stiff synthetic angle brushes for artists. A smaller brush with a sharp angle is ideal for creating fine details and lines, while a larger brush with a more gradual angle is better suited for broad strokes and textured effects. Artists should consider the specific techniques and effects they want to achieve and choose a brush that is tailored to their needs. For example, a brush with a 1/2 inch flat edge and a sharp angle is perfect for creating sharp lines and edges, while a brush with a 1 inch flat edge and a more gradual angle is better suited for creating soft, blended textures.

The size and shape of the brush also impact the overall control and precision of the brushstrokes. A brush with a smaller head and a sharp angle allows for more precise control, making it ideal for detailed work and fine lines. On the other hand, a brush with a larger head and a more gradual angle provides a softer, more expressive stroke, making it perfect for loose, gestural painting. Brush Material and Quality

The material and quality of the brush are also essential factors to consider when buying stiff synthetic angle brushes for artists. Synthetic brushes are made from a variety of materials, including nylon, polyester, and polypropylene, each with its own unique characteristics and advantages. Nylon brushes, for example, are known for their durability and resistance to wear and tear, making them ideal for heavy use and textured effects. Polyester brushes, on the other hand, are softer and more flexible, making them perfect for smooth, blended strokes.

The quality of the brush is also critical, as it affects the overall performance and longevity of the brush. A high-quality brush with synthetic fibers that are evenly spaced and securely attached to the ferrule will provide a smooth, consistent stroke and last longer than a lower-quality brush. Artists should look for brushes with high-quality materials and construction, such as those with reinforced ferrules and precision-crafted tips. By investing in a high-quality brush, artists can ensure that their brush will withstand the demands of frequent use and maintain its performance over time.
